Psychology The process of functioning differently than, and in reciprocation to, someone else, by responding to that person's activities, behavior, and … WebIn summary, the complementation test is used to assign mutant alleles to specific genetic loci. Mutant alleles of the same gene fail to complement one another, while alleles of different genes do complement each other. Webcomplementation group a collection of MUTANT ALLELES that fails to complement and restore the WILD TYPE when tested in all pair-wise combinations (see CIS-TRANS TEST ). The complementation group is initially used to define the basic genetic unit of function or CISTRON (now synonymous with GENE ). WebDefinitions of complementation. noun. WebA complement blood test measures the amount or activity of complement proteins in the blood. Complement proteins are part of the complement system. This system is made up of a group of proteins that work with the immune system to identify and fight disease-causing substances like viruses and bacteria. There are nine major complement proteins. WebSep 15, 2024 · Complementation: In genetics, complementation refers to a relationship between two different strains of an organism which both have homozygous recessive mutations that produce the same phenotype (for example, a change in wing structure in flies) but which do not reside on the same (homologous) gene.
